Transaction 5dad73aada7051cf4563605440a452e5f900e1c28792d03dc16c34151beed70e
3 Input
2 Outputs
- 5dad73aada7051cf4563605440a452e5f900e1c28792d03dc16c34151beed70e:0
- 5dad73aada7051cf4563605440a452e5f900e1c28792d03dc16c34151beed70e:1
value 1914396
address 2N2ay9jdY14xpugzJSJW3T7vR9ppJrcz8rB
value 1053233
address mmXbwUc7RAWYsD8awXKnwRceeUy9KzcRBA